The vehicle range is fitted with the "New Generation 2.0L Zetec-E engine". The most significant features are:
- Hydraulic engine mountings
- valve DOHC
- Full flow oil filter
- Aluminum alloy cylinder head
- Cast iron block
- High temperature resistant coating on exhaust valves
- Valve train with mechanical tappets
- Modified timing belt guide
- Aluminum timing belt cover with integral engine mounting function to reduce noise, vibration and harshness (NVH)
- Aluminum crankcase reinforcement and flat oil pan to reduce NVH
- Generator with check-back function for generator load
The changes made are:
- close coupled tri-metal catalytic converter
- EGR system
- Adjustable valve tappets
- use of a cylinder head temperature (CHT) sensor in place of an engine coolant temperature (ECT) sensor.
